This amazing lumber is Celotex, developed five years ago to meet the urgent need for a building material that would resist the passage of heat and cold better than wood lumber, masonry and other wall and roof materials. : Celotex is not cut from trees, but is manufactured from the long, tough fibres of cane. It is enduring ... scientifically sterilized and waterproofed. Celo- tex is stronger in walls than wood lumber, because of the greater bracing angle of the broad boards, and many times better as insulation. Wood and mois- ture can not penetrate Celotex.
